THE OLD SCHOOL, family friendly, with open fire in Downham Market

This delightful converted school is resting in the pretty village green of Wereham, in the Norfolk countryside and can sleep six people in three bedrooms.

The Old School is a lovely converted school in the village of Wereham, Norfolk. Hosting three bedrooms: one super king-size and two twins, sleeping a total of six people and served by an en-suite shower room, family bathroom and shower room. Downstairs has a fitted kitchen/diner, a separate utility, dining room and a sitting room with a woodburning stove. Outside has an enclosed lawned garden and patio area with furniture, as well as off-road parking. The Old School is a wonderful choice for a rural-based holiday to the heart of the countryside. Pet charge: 40 GBP per pet.

Amenities: Oil central heating, woodburning stove. Range electric oven and hob, microwave, toaster, kettle, fridge/freezer, wine coolers, washing machine, dishwasher, TV and WiFi. Heating oil and electricity for lighting and domestic appliances is included in the rent. Logs for the wood burner, along with kindling and firelighters can be purchased in nearby garages or supermarkets. Bed linen and towels inc. in rent. Ample off-road parking. Enclosed lawned garden and patio areas with furniture. One well-behaved pet welcome. Sorry, no smoking. Shop 5.4 miles and pub 0.1 miles. Region: Picturesque rolling Fens, unspoilt beaches, and pretty waterways – East Anglia is a dream holiday destination. Norfolk offers beaches, saltmarshes and quaint villages whilst equally as charming are the coast and countryside of Suffolk.

Town: Downham Market is a market town and civil parish resting in the Norfolk countryside of England. Boasting a plethora of shops, supermarkets, pubs and restaurants for fine food and local produce. You are a few miles from the thriving town of King's Lynn and within reach of the Norfolk coastline offering a choice of lovely sandy beaches and plenty of trails for walking and cycling opportunities.
